Comprehending Membrane Switch Modern Technology
Membrane button technology might appear complex, it operates on straightforward concepts that enhance user interfaces in different gadgets. This modern technology includes slim, flexible layers that create an integrated circuit, allowing for seamless interaction between the device and the user. Typically, a membrane switch comprises a visuals overlay, a spacer, and a circuit layer, all designed to provide a efficient and sturdy option for managing electronic functions.The graphic overlay, usually printed with lively layouts, provides visual guidance while functioning as the main touch surface. Beneath it, the spacer layer maintains the circuit layer and overlay divided till stress is applied, finishing the circuit. When a customer presses a switch, the layers enter into get in touch with, resulting in an electrical signal that turns on the gadget. This simplicity, integrated with adaptability, allows Membrane switches to be efficiently utilized in a variety of applications, from consumer electronics to commercial tools.
